WitrynaExamples of strong and weak electrolytes-. Strong acid- eg, HCl, HI, HBr, HNO3, HNO3, HClO3. Strong bases- eg, NaOH, KOH, LiOH, Ba (OH)2. Salts- eg NaCl, KBr, MgCl2, and many more. In solution or molten form, these electrolytes are totally ionized. As a result, these compounds only contain ions in a liquid or molten form. Witryna16 wrz 2024 · Strong Electrolyte Examples. Strong acids, strong bases, and ionic salts that are not weak acids or bases are strong electrolytes. Salts much have high solubility in the solvent to act as strong electrolytes. WitrynaThese include the ionic compounds and the strong acids and bases. (ch3ch2)2o is an organic compound. Thus, it is covalent so you would expect this to be a nonelectrolyte or a weak electrolyte. MgI ₂ is an ionic compound between the Mg²⁺ and I⁻ ions. Thus, you would expect this to be an electrolyte. Witryna1. The compound magnesium iodide is a strong electrolyte.
